#d9b854 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9b854 is composed of 85.1% red, 72.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 45.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 59%. #d9b854 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#b37100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d9b854 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d9b854 has RGB values of R:217, G:184,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.61,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14268500.

Shades and Tints of #d9b854

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060401 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9b854

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999894 is the less saturated color, while #f9c834 is the most saturated one.
